Latest Patents

Sung Hee Cho holds a patent for a "Method for preparing spherical phosphor particles." This patent describes a process where a precursor solution of phosphors is decomposed into solid particles through aerosol pyrolysis and rapid cooling. The solid particles are then heat-treated at temperatures ranging from 1000°C to 1600°C for a duration of 1 to 9 hours. This method enhances the quality and efficiency of phosphor particles, making them suitable for advanced applications.
